"roon will not send anything greater than 24/96 to Chromecast devices. In the world of the Chromecast SDK, devices either advertise that they support 24/96 or they do not; there is currently no way for developers to determine with certainty that a device is capable of more. The signal path in your screenshot shows that Roon is resampling 24/192 content down to 24/96 before sending it to the C338, which is exactly what is expected. My statement was more of a hypothetical question regarding what would happen if we had a C338 in-house and what would happen if we blindly fed 24/192 content to the Chromecast implementation on the device.

If you’re concerned about avoiding downsampling of 24/192 content, I would look into a Roon Ready bridge device plugged into one of the C338’s digital inputs or an external DAC via one of the analog inputs. I don’t think Chromecast ecosystem support for >24/96 is a high priority for Google and we can’t do much without the right developer tools."
